signing an aws s3 url

# encoding : utf-8 | |
require 'openssl' | |
require 'digest/sha1' | |
require 'base64' | |
module Aws | |
extend self | |
def signed_url(path, expire_date) | |
digest = OpenSSL::Digest::Digest.new('sha1') | |
can_string = "GET\n\n\n#{expire_date}\n/#{S3_BUCKET}/#{path}" | |
hmac = OpenSSL::HMAC.digest(digest, S3_SECRET_ACCESS_KEY, can_string) | |
signature = URI.escape(Base64.encode64(hmac).strip).encode_signs | |
"https://s3.amazonaws.com/#{S3_BUCKET}/#{path}?AWSAccessKeyId=#{S3_ACCESS_KEY_ID}&Expires=#{expire_date}&Signature=#{signature}" | |
end | |
end | |
class String | |
def encode_signs | |
signs = {'+' => "%2B", '=' => "%3D", '?' => '%3F', '@' => '%40', | |
'$' => '%24', '&' => '%26', ',' => '%2C', '/' => '%2F', ':' => '%3A', | |
';' => '%3B', '?' => '%3F'} | |
signs.keys.each do |key| | |
self.gsub!(key, signs[key]) | |
end | |
self | |
end | |
end |
